Pneumatic knife gate valve
Pneumatic Knife Gate Valves combine a sharp knife-edge gate with a pneumatic actuator, enabling automated on/off operation in abrasive or solid-laden pipelines. Suitable for medium- to large-diameter valves, the design ensures smooth flow, prevents clogging, and reduces operating torque.
Available in carbon steel, stainless steel, and alloy steel, the valves can be installed with flanged, wafer, or lug connections. OEM customization options include special materials, actuator types, gate and seat designs, and coatings for harsh operating conditions.
Pneumatic knife gate valve
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Product Name | Pneumatic Knife Gate Valve |
| Nominal Size | DN50 – DN1200 (2" – 48") |
| Pressure Rating | PN10 – PN40 |
| ANSI Class | Class 150 – Class 300 |
| Body Material | Carbon Steel, Stainless Steel, Alloy Steel, Ductile Iron |
| Gate Material | Stainless Steel, Hardfaced Alloy, Wear-Resistant Steel |
| Seat Material | EPDM, NBR, PTFE, Metal Seat |
| Connection Type | Flanged, Wafer, Lug |
| Operation | Pneumatic Actuation, Manual Override |
| Temperature Range | -20°C to +250°C |
| Sealing Type | Bi-directional / Uni-directional |
| Leakage Standard | API 598 / ISO 5208 Class A |
| Design Standard | API 609, ASME B16.34 |
| Applicable Media | Slurry, Pulp, Wastewater, Chemicals, Abrasive Fluids |
